2016-01-28 2 views

ответ

2

Вы можете добавить @dependsOnMethods and alwaysRun свойства следующим образом:

@Test 
public void Test1() throws Exception { ... } 

@Test(dependsOnMethods = {"Test1", ..., ...}, alwaysRun = false) 
public void Test2() throws Exception { ... } 
+0

[ 'alwaysRun'] (http://testng.org/javadoc/org/testng/annotations/Test.html#alwaysRun()) по умолчанию для' false' так что вы даже не нужно указывать его. – mfulton26

+0

Вы правы, сэр. Это для разъяснений :) – Idos

+0

Спасибо за этот ответ! @Idos –

1

Вы также можете установить тест как @BeforeSuite, и в случае не в состоянии бросить любое исключение - все ожидающие тесты будут пропущены. Она также будет работать с @BeforeMethod, @BeforeTest и @BeforeClass

Смежные вопросы